[发明专利]基于遗传算法和启发式策略的电商订单装箱优化方法有效
申请号: | 201910908716.4 | 申请日: | 2019-09-25 |
公开(公告)号: | CN110705765B | 公开(公告)日: | 2022-03-11 |
发明(设计)人: | 吴秀丽;李晶 | 申请(专利权)人: | 北京科技大学 |
主分类号: | G06Q10/04 | 分类号: | G06Q10/04;G06Q10/08;G06N3/12 |
代理公司: | 北京金智普华知识产权代理有限公司 11401 | 代理人: | 皋吉甫 |
地址: | 100083*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 遗传 算法 启发式 策略 订单 装箱 优化 方法 | ||
1.基于遗传算法和启发式策略的电商订单装箱优化方法,其特征在于,该优化方法将电商订单分割为裸送货物和非裸送货物;对于非裸送货物,根据货物的数量多少,选择采用枚举法、结合块处理的遗传算法、或者模块化方法得到所述非裸送货物针对不同快递商的物流成本;加总所述裸送货物和非裸送货物的物流成本,得到所述电商订单对于不同快递商的总物流成本和装箱方案;输出总物流成本最低所对应的快递商及装箱方案;其中,所述枚举法、块处理法、模块化法均为启发式策略,遗传算法中包含启发式策略;所述裸送货物为自带包装、不需要再用纸箱包装的大件货物,所述非裸送货物为需要装箱的货物;
该方法具体包括:
S1、导入数据,所述数据包括电商订单数据、快递价格、箱型数据;设置遗传算法参数,所述遗传算法参数包括种群规模、迭代次数、代沟、交叉概率和变异概率;
S2、分离电商订单中的裸送货物和非裸送货物,计算裸送货物对于不同快递商的快递成本;转到步骤S3计算非裸送货物对于不同快递商的物流成本;所述物流成本包括纸箱成本和快递成本两部分;
S3、若货物数量=N1,转到步骤S4;若N1货物数量=N2,转到步骤S5;若货物数量N2,转到步骤S6;
S4、对于货物数量=N1的订单,采用枚举法计算物流成本;转到步骤S7;
S5、对于N1货物数量=N2的订单,先对货物进行块处理;若块数量=N1,转到步骤S4用枚举法计算;否则用遗传算法迭代优化得到物流成本;转到步骤S7;
S6、对于货物数量N2的订单,先进行整箱模块化处理,将货物分成整箱和散件两部分;直接计算整箱货物物流成本,散件货物物流成本利用步骤S5计算;转到步骤S7;
S7、计算得到非裸送货物对于不同快递商的物流成本后,与裸送货物进行加和,得到该订单对于不同快递商的总物流成本及对应装箱方案;输出物流成本最低的装箱方案、对应快递商和物流成本。
2.如权利要求1所述的基于遗传算法和启发式策略的电商订单装箱优化方法,其特征在于,所述优化方法的目标为总物流成本最低,选择总物流成本最低的快递商安排寄送;
目标函数为:
min(Cost总k),k=1,2,3…K (1)
约束条件为:
Cost总=CostA+CostB (2)
VjVmaxj(1-Percent预留),j=1,2,3…N (6)
l货≤l箱,xij=1,i=1,2,3…M,j=1,2,3…N (7)
w货≤w箱,xij=1,i=1,2,3…M,j=1,2,3…N (8)
h货≤h箱,xij=1,i=1,2,3…M,j=1,2,3…N (9)
式(1)为目标函数,K为待选快递商的总个数;k为第k个快递商;
式(2)为每种快递商定价下装箱方案的总物流成本计算公式,总物流成本等于裸送货物和非裸送货物的物流成本之和;
式(3)为每种快递商定价下裸送货物的快递成本,若总重不超过首重则按照首重收费,若超过首重则超出部分向上取整乘以续重每单位价格;
式(4)为每种快递商定价下非裸送货物的总成本,等于快递成本与纸箱成本之和;
式(5)表示一件货物只能放入一个箱子中;
式(6)表示每个箱子都有一定的预留空间,盛装货物的总体积不得超过箱子预留空间以外的最大体积;
式(7)、式(8)、式(9)分别表示货物摆放方向的长、宽、高不得超过箱子对应尺寸;
其中:Cost总k表示在第k个快递商定价策略下优化得到的总物流成本;对于某种快递商定价策略,Cost总是该定价策略下的总物流成本,CostA和CostB分别表示该定价策略下裸送货物和非裸送货物的总物流成本;W总表示订单总重,W首表示对应快递商的首重,Pf表示首重收费价格,Pa表示单位重量续重收费价格;ECost和BCost分别表示非裸送货物在对应快递商定价策略下的快递成本和纸箱成本,N是订单使用的箱子总数,Pbj是第j个箱子的成本;M是货物总数,xij=1表示第i个货物放入第j个箱中,xij=0则不放入;Vj表示第j个箱子盛装货物的总体积,Vmaxj表示第j个箱子的最大容量,Percent预留表示箱子预留空间占最大容量的百分比;l,w,h分别表示货物或者箱子对应某种摆放方向的长、宽、高。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京科技大学,未经北京科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910908716.4/1.html,转载请声明来源钻瓜专利网。
- 同类专利
- 专利分类
G06Q 专门适用于行政、商业、金融、管理、监督或预测目的的数据处理系统或方法;其他类目不包含的专门适用于行政、商业、金融、管理、监督或预测目的的处理系统或方法
G06Q10-00 行政;管理
G06Q10-02 .预定,例如用于门票、服务或事件的
G06Q10-04 .预测或优化,例如线性规划、“旅行商问题”或“下料问题”
G06Q10-06 .资源、工作流、人员或项目管理,例如组织、规划、调度或分配时间、人员或机器资源;企业规划;组织模型
G06Q10-08 .物流,例如仓储、装货、配送或运输;存货或库存管理,例如订货、采购或平衡订单
G06Q10-10 .办公自动化,例如电子邮件或群件的计算机辅助管理